The Major League Soccer’s All-Star Game for this season is set to showcase a match against the best of Liga MX for the third time in the past four years. This announcement was made by MLS on Monday, revealing that the exhibition game will take place on July 24 at Lower.com Field in Columbus, Ohio. After hosting Arsenal in 2023, this year’s MLS All-Star Game marks a return to the MLS vs. Liga MX format. The previous encounters between the two leagues occurred in 2021 and 2022, with MLS emerging victorious each time.

Following the MLS All-Star Game, the Leagues Cup tournament is scheduled to commence on July 26, featuring clubs from both Liga MX and MLS. This “World Cup style” competition has gained popularity over the years, showcasing the best talent from North America. Additionally, the Campeones Cup will see reigning MLS Cup champions Columbus Crew face off against Liga MX’s 2023-24 Campeon de Campeones winners later this year. These events serve as a platform to highlight the top clubs and players from both leagues.
The roster for the MLS All-Star Game will be determined through a combination of fan votes, selection by the All-Star coach, and additional picks by MLS Commissioner Don Garber. On the other hand, details regarding the 26-man roster for Liga MX are yet to be revealed. In addition to the main game, there will also be a Skills Challenge held on July 23, where both leagues have had equal success in the past.
